Afghanistan: Civilian Deaths Hit 'Record Levels' -- BBC

The number of civilians killed in Afghanistan since the US-led invasion a decade ago hit record levels last year, according to a new report.

Some 2,421 civilians were killed, most at the hands of insurgents, the Kabul-based Afghanistan Rights Monitor said.

Foreign troops were to blame for about a fifth of all deaths - a slight fall on the previous year, the report says.

Correspondents say most officials are expecting at least the same level of violence, if not higher, this year.
